The preservation of traditional art forms like Thundu Kathakal is crucial for maintaining cultural heritage and promoting cultural diversity. These art forms provide a window into the past, allowing us to understand the customs, traditions, and values of our ancestors. They also provide a platform for creative expression and innovation, allowing artists to experiment with new ideas and techniques.
